Output 21e336ce84806c0fa1f199be22723e99ddb87002061878dc4dfaf289db41d5da:1

value
1069991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f985ca7fc3efcb9d7a4579f08d1a612f2503dcaa OP_EQUAL
address
3QSNTGjJvQtxZZDpJhwSkHbffqHC82Lhy7
transaction
21e336ce84806c0fa1f199be22723e99ddb87002061878dc4dfaf289db41d5da
spent
true